US Automotive Logistics Market Overview:
As per MRFR analysis, the US Automotive Logistics Market Size was estimated at 23.15 (USD Billion) in 2023. The US Automotive Logistics Market Industry is expected to grow from 23.81 (USD Billion) in 2024 to 31.75 (USD Billion) by 2035. The US Automotive Logistics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 2.652%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

US Automotive Logistics Market Drivers
Growth in E-Commerce and Online Vehicle Sales
The US Automotive Logistics Market Industry is experiencing substantial growth due to the rise of e-commerce and online vehicle sales. In 2022, online auto sales accounted for over 19% of total vehicle sales in the United States, highlighting a trend towards digital transformation in the automotive sector. Major automotive players like Ford and General Motors are increasingly investing in e-commerce platforms to streamline their sales channels, facilitating more efficient logistics.
As customers increasingly prefer the convenience of online shopping, the demand for innovative logistics solutions has surged, necessitating improvements in supply chain efficiencies and distribution networks to meet consumer expectations. According to the National Association of Automobile Dealers, this trend is expected to continue with a projected annual increase of 15% in online sales until 2025, driving the need for better logistics capabilities in the US Automotive Logistics Market Industry.
Technological Advancements in Supply Chain Management
Technological innovations in supply chain management are pivotal for the US Automotive Logistics Market Industry's growth. The introduction of Internet of Things (IoT) devices and artificial intelligence (AI) solutions allows for real-time tracking and improved operational efficiencies. For instance, a study by the American Automotive Policy Council indicates that by 2025, about 80% of automotive companies in the US are expected to implement advanced technologies in their logistics operations.This transition not only enhances delivery times but also allows companies to reduce costs significantly. Established logistics providers, such as UPS and FedEx, are leading this charge by investing in advanced logistics technology, thereby setting industry standards and driving competition.
Rising Demand for Electric Vehicles (EVs)
The US Automotive Logistics Market Industry is poised for growth with the increasing demand for Electric Vehicles (EVs). According to the U.S. Department of Energy, EV sales in the United States increased by over 70% from 2020 to 2021, marking a significant shift in consumer preferences. This shift necessitates specialized logistics solutions tailored for EV manufacturers, which are often different from traditional vehicle logistics due to the unique needs of battery management and related components.Major players like Tesla and Nissan are expanding their production capacities, meaning that logistics companies must adapt quickly to support this burgeoning segment. Industry analysts predict that the EV market will represent over 30% of total vehicle sales by 2030, which will drive substantial changes in the logistics landscape.

Automotive Logistics Market Logistics Mode Insights
The Logistics Mode segment of the US Automotive Logistics Market plays a pivotal role in ensuring the efficient transportation of vehicles and automotive parts across the nation. This segment is essential for maintaining the supply chain integrity, facilitating timely deliveries, and meeting consumer demands, which has become increasingly critical in today's fast-paced market. The Road logistics mode remains a dominant force, given its flexibility in direct deliveries and last-mile efficiency. Meanwhile, the Rail mode offers a cost-effective solution for bulk transportation of vehicles, providing a sustainable alternative through reduced carbon emissions.
On the other hand, the Air mode is essential for time-sensitive deliveries, ensuring that luxury and high-demand vehicles reach their destinations swiftly. Lastly, the Sea mode is significant for international trade, allowing the transport of numerous vehicles efficiently across global markets. The growth of e-commerce and the demand for just-in-time production have further emphasized the importance of optimizing these logistics modes. Balancing these modes is crucial for enhancing supply chain resilience in the automotive industry, ultimately aligning with the evolving landscape of consumer preferences and technological advances.

US Automotive Logistics Market Industry Developments
The US Automotive Logistics Market continues to evolve with significant developments. In October 2023, Maersk expanded its logistics services focused on electric vehicle (EV) transportation, aligning with the growing market for sustainable automotive solutions. Meanwhile, J.B. Hunt Transport Services announced enhancements to its intermodal capabilities, aiming to streamline operations amid ongoing supply chain challenges. Additionally, Schneider National reported a notable increase in freight capacity utilization, revealing a robust demand for logistics services in the automotive sector.
In terms of mergers and acquisitions, Ryder System acquired a smaller logistics firm in August 2023 to bolster its capabilities in the EV logistics space. The market has also seen valuation growth, with companies like XPO Logistics and UPS Supply Chain Solutions reporting significant growth in revenue due to increased demand for efficient automotive distribution. Over the past couple of years, advancements in technology and shifts towards sustainability have profoundly impacted the logistics strategies adopted by major players such as C.H. Robinson and DB Schenker, indicating a trend towards more integrated and environmentally friendly logistics solutions in the automotive market.
